Transaction c351f31c60b00baff5a29b5a31ae94390a4e072ce604305783a4f629ed7ea076
1 Input
1 Output
-
c351f31c60b00baff5a29b5a31ae94390a4e072ce604305783a4f629ed7ea076:0
- value
- 449689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45b1c9b8f87eb0f89930fa024dec9d6e5fc727ca OP_EQUAL
- address
- 383XXhs8LFYtdEVj6rQzDVQG66mxyyTEru